There is no official postal code or zip code for Vélé, as the Cameroon postal service does not use codes for sorting or "door-to-door" delivery. The system relies almost exclusively on P.O. Boxes (French: Boîte Postale or BP). If an online form requires a mandatory code, 00000 (five zeros) can be used as a placeholder, but this is not an official code. For successful delivery, a valid P.O. Box (BP) number is essential. A sample P.O. Box address is: [Recipient Name], BP [XXXX], Vélé, Mayo-Danay, Extrême-Nord, Cameroon.

Vélé is a commune located within the Mayo-Danay department in Cameroon's Extrême-Nord region. Situated in the northernmost part of Cameroon, Vélé lies within the vast Mayo-Danay plain, characterized by its semi-arid landscape and seasonal river systems that support agricultural activities. This commune occupies an area of approximately 450 square kilometers and serves as home to around 35,000 residents, primarily from the Massa and Tupuri ethnic groups who maintain traditional farming practices alongside modern agricultural development. Vélé is administratively divided into several villages and quarters, with its economy centered around subsistence farming, particularly millet, sorghum, and cotton cultivation, along with livestock rearing that takes advantage of the seasonal grazing lands. The commune experiences a typical Sahelian climate with distinct dry and rainy seasons, which significantly influences agricultural cycles and water resource management. Vélé maintains important cultural traditions through local festivals and ceremonies that celebrate harvests and community heritage.
